Population By Race and Ethnicity in Barron, WI in 2014

Updated on June 16, 2025.

Based on the US Census Vintage data estimates, in 2014, the 45,355 population of Barron County, Wisconsin comprised of 1,078 people who identified as Hispanic (2.38%), and 44,277 people who identified as Non-Hispanic (97.62%).

Race: The White Alone population was the largest racial group in Barron County, Wisconsin with a population of 43,666 (96.28%); Two Or More Races population was the second largest racial group with a population of 520 (1.15%); and Black or African American Alone was the third largest racial group with a population of 451 (0.99%).

Ethnicity: The White Alone - Non Hispanic population was the largest ethnic group in Barron County, Wisconsin in 2014, with a population of 42,735 (94.22%); the second largest ethnic group was White Alone - Hispanic with a population of 931 (2.05%); and the third largest ethnic group was Two Or More Races - Non Hispanic with a population of 485 (1.07%).

Population By Race in Barron , WI in 2014
Race Population Percentage
Black or African American Alone 451 0.99%
White Alone 43,666 96.28%
American Indian and Alaska Native Alone 440 0.97%
Asian Alone 272 0.6%
Native Hawaiian And Pacific Islander Alone 6 0.01%
Two Or More Races 520 1.15%
Population By Ethnicity in Barron , WI in 2014
Ethnicity Population Percentage
Black or African American Alone - Hispanic 34 0.08%
White Alone - Hispanic 931 2.05%
American Indian and Alaska Native Alone - Hispanic 73 0.16%
Asian Alone - Hispanic 3 0.01%
Native Hawaiian And Pacific Islander Alone - Hispanic 2 0%
Two Or More Races - Hispanic 35 0.08%
Black or African American Alone - Non Hispanic 417 0.92%
White Alone - Non Hispanic 42,735 94.22%
American Indian and Alaska Native Alone - Non Hispanic 367 0.81%
Asian Alone - Non Hispanic 269 0.59%
Native Hawaiian And Pacific Islander Alone - Non Hispanic 4 0.01%
Two Or More Races - Non Hispanic 485 1.07%
